Young
and old, married or single, ladies
have found the Women of the Word
class to be a safe haven to learn
more about God through His Word.
Fellowship time begins at 9:15 a.m.
This provides an opportunity for
sisters in Christ to encourage one
another over snacks and a cup of
coffee or tea. Inspiring teaching by
Ruth Birdsong and Lisa Otto follows.
These exceptional teachers have many
years of experience and, most
importantly, a heart desire to see
women grow closer to their Lord and
Savior through Bible study and
prayer.
Regular socials are scheduled
throughout the year with free child
care provided at the church. These
get-togethers might be an evening of
Bunko, swimming, or a tacky party
where you can show off your tackiest
attire. WOW also endeavors to
minister within the community by
providing Christmas presents to
clients of The Bridge and needy
families. An overnight retreat, held
annually, is always a time of
reflection and refreshment.
Various topical and book studies
designed to meet the needs of women
who want to learn more about God
continue throughout the year. If
you’re looking to build a stronger
relationship with the Lord and make
new friends along the way, come join
us. Visitors and new members are
welcome to pick up the current study
at any point.
